HOW DID HE PROPOSE?

I had made plans to go to Wicked Tulips tulip farm in Preston, CT, just for a fun trip to do together that was “covid safe”. We arrived at the tulip farm on a nice sunny may afternoon. He commented that there were a lot of people there, and I thought nothing of it. He brought me over to the back corner of the tulip field and I started to pick some pretty tulips. When I turned around he was down on one knee and proposed. It was perfect and so unexpected!
